68. Pedicularis ser. Oliganthae Prain, Ann. Roy. Bot. Gard. (Calcutta). 3: 75. 1890.
少花系 shao hua xi
Stems usually many branched at base. Leaves basal and on stem, alternate, sometimes proximal ones ± opposite, long petiolate, oblong to lanceolate, pinnatisect or pinnatipartite. Inflorescences short spicate, capitate, or racemose, few flowered. Calyx deeply cleft anteriorly, 2--5-lobed. Corolla purple or yellowish white; tube less than 2 X as long as calyx; galea purple, strongly twisted laterally, commonly with 1 or 2 reflexed marginal teeth; beak slender.
Seven species.
